Education and Expertise

Payal K. Patel earned her Doctor of Medicine (M.D.) with Distinction in Research from UT Health San Antonio, where she studied from 2006 to 2010. She also holds a Master of Public Health (MPH) from Harvard T.H. Chan School of Public Health, completed in 2015. Additionally, she obtained a Bachelor of Arts in Public Health from The Johns Hopkins University between 2001 and 2005. Background

Payal K. Patel has a diverse professional background in medicine and public health. She completed her Internal Medicine residency at the University of Texas Health Science Center San Antonio from 2010 to 2013. Following her residency, she worked as an Infectious Diseases Fellow at Beth Israel Deaconess Hospital, Harvard Medical School, from 2013 to 2015. She then served as an Associate Professor at the University of Michigan Medical School and as a Staff Infectious Diseases Physician at the Veterans Affairs Hospital in Ann Arbor, MI, from 2015 to 2022.
